#511806 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#511806 is composed of 31.8% red, 9.4% green and 2.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 70.4% magenta, 92.6% yellow and 68.2% black. It has a hue angle of 14.4 degrees, a saturation of 86.2% and a lightness of 17.1%. #511806 color hex could be obtained by blending #a2300c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

Shades and Tints of #511806
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080201 is the darkest color, while #fef7f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#511806
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2c2b2b is the less saturated color, while #541603 is the most saturated one.
